**ALERT: Upstream health checks failing behind the Ferngate balancer**

Plugin endpoints must answer the balancer's probe within 2 seconds or they are drained from rotation. Most failures come from plugins blocking the probe path during startup. Return 200 before heavy initialization completes, or register a warmup grace period. Probe configuration details are maintained internally here:

operations page: https://confluence.tolvaqsys.corp/spaces/pages/pages/6e787158f507

## Further reading

If you're on support and someone asks why the Pennygate payments service shows red builds half the time, it's usually the flaky integration tests, not a real outage. The suspects are the ledger-reconciliation suite and anything touching the sandbox card processor — they time out when the test cluster is busy. Don't panic customers about failed pipelines; check whether the failure is on the known-flaky list first. We keep the current list, retry guidance, and quarantine history on the internal page below.

wiki page, tahaf-tajog: https://jira.ordindyn.corp/pipeline

## Artifact Signing

The Burrowlane 2.8 patch fixes the infamous N+1 query in our GraphQL resolver — batching via the loader layer, finally. Before shipping, run the query-count regression test; it should show a flat line, not a staircase. Once it's green, build the artifact as usual and sign it with the key right below this paragraph.

rollout seal: bky3_Zik

TICKET-2087 (for weekly eng sync): The Mossvale cron drift investigation stalled because the credential used by the Tickrow scheduler to query the Ambergrid timing service expired on the 3rd. Drift data has a four-day gap; please note this caveat when reviewing the charts. We have re-provisioned the credential with a 180-day lifetime and filed a follow-up to automate rotation. The new key for the Ambergrid timing service is provided below.

API key for fahip-kahip: zpat23_XiJGUHz5xfaAtaIqUkus0rh